Inspection Procedure
NOTE:
Allowing the drive belt tensioner to snap into the free position may result in damage to the tensioner.
Important: When the engine is operating the drive belt tensioner arm will move. Do not replace the drive belt tensioner because of movement in the drive belt tensioner arm.
- Remove the drive belt. Refer to Drive Belt Replacement .
- Position a 3/8 inch drive wrench on the drive belt tensioner arm and rotate the arm counterclockwise.
- Move the drive belt tensioner through its full travel.
- The movement should feel smooth.
- There should be no binding.
- The tensioner should return freely.
- If any binding is observed, replace the drive belt tensioner. Refer to Drive Belt Tensioner Replacement .
- Install the drive belt. Refer to Drive Belt Replacement .
